Position Title: TEACHER

Supervisor: Head of School

The Cherry Hill School is a welcoming Jewish-based institution that embraces all faiths and cultures. With a dedicated Board of Directors, engaged community members, and supportive parents, the school is passionately committed to helping every student meet the highest academic standards while offering tailored support to ensure their success.

We are seeking a teacher to join our inclusive, non-profit elementary/middle school that features a STEAM-based, constructivist curriculum, starting August 1, 2026. Our environment supports small class sizes of 15 students or fewer and emphasizes creativity and student-centered learning, with involvement from board members, community stakeholders, and parents.

· Candidates should be committed to high academic standards for students and skilled at scaffolding abilities to support their success.

· Experience in planning, teaching, and collaborating with middle school team teachers is valued.

· Background or familiarity with AP-Spanish is beneficial.

· Familiarity with PRE AP classes is also preferred.

· A thorough understanding of the subject area and the ability to design and teach comprehensive units for deep learning are essential.

· Applicants should strive to develop dynamic, challenging lessons that prepare students for AP exams.

· The role requires clear communication of complex topics so middle school students can access and understand the material.

· Students’ regular assessment data should inform planning for small-group and one-on-one instruction.

· Ability to apply Understanding by Design methodology for Project-Based Learning connected to CCSS and AP test skills, including the creation of grading rubrics, is necessary.

We welcome educators from both traditional and non-traditional backgrounds. Application review begins immediately and will continue until the position is filled.

GENERA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

· Display expertise in assigned subjects and communicate this knowledge effectively.

· Create unit plans aligned with Common Core Standards.

· Maintain a safe, organized classroom that promotes independent learning, collaboration, choice, and engages students using various teaching strategies.

· Assess student progress and use this data to guide planning, instruction, and differentiation.

· Utilize available technology and instructional media to enhance students’ learning experiences.

· Provide responses that meet children’s developmental, social, and emotional needs.

· Promote an atmosphere of mutual respect among parents, staff, and students.

· Participate in occasional support duties, school events, fundraisers, and collaborate with colleagues and leadership on program and mission innovations.

· Design classrooms that are student-focused, visually appealing, and well-organized with relevant materials, resources, and activities.

· Develop and adapt lesson materials to encourage active student engagement.

CERTIFICATION:

· Bachelor’s or Master’s degree required.

· Valid Texas Teaching Certificate preferred.

BENEFITS:

· Paid time off.

· On-site continuing education opportunities.
